The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.
The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.
Patent No.:
Date of Patent:
May. 29, 2018
Filed:
Dec. 11, 2015
Renesas Electronics Corporation, Tokyo, JP;
Naoshi Ishikawa, Tokyo, JP;
Renesas Electronics Corporation, Tokyo, JP;
Abstract
The present invention provides a technique for further improving the processing efficiency in a semiconductor device that arbitrates data transfer between a plurality of bus masters and a plurality of bus slaves. A bus control circuit controls data transfer in an address bus and a data bus between a plurality of bus masters and a plurality of bus slaves. The bus control circuit obtains access information representing the bus slave that each of the bus masters accesses on the basis of address signals output from the bus masters. The bus control circuit obtains busy information representing whether or not each bus slave is in a busy state. In the case where the bus masters compete with each other when accessing a bus slave, the bus control circuit arbitrates access from each bus master to the bus slave that is not in a busy state in accordance with the priority set for each bus master on the basis of the access information and the busy information.